Hennepin County to computerize absentee ballot distribution
A computer system will soon be creating and mailing absentee ballots to the tens of thousands of Hennepin County voters who request them. The County Board approved a $1.6 million, five-year contract Tuesday with BlueCrest for an absentee ballot software and mailing system. Iowa lawmakers advance ballot measure requiring two-thirds approval for income tax hikes
Iowa legislators moved a step closer Wednesday toward making it much more difficult to raise income taxes in the state. State senators on Wednesday approved a proposed constitutional amendment that would require a two-thirds vote to approve income tax increases and help deter efforts to reverse Republican-led tax cuts passed in recent years.
